圖像處理裝置和圖像處理方法
【專(zhuān)利摘要】本發(fā)明涉及增強(qiáng)現(xiàn)實(shí)(AR)技術(shù),其能夠在由相機(jī)所捕獲的自然背景等的數(shù)字圖像上實(shí)時(shí)地合成及顯示具有合適位置、尺寸及定向的CG對(duì)象,而無(wú)需手動(dòng)定位操作。本發(fā)明的特征在于:通過(guò)第一AR分析器(3A)分析由相機(jī)(1)捕獲并且包括AR標(biāo)記圖像的第一捕獲圖像,以便確定AR標(biāo)記圖像在視場(chǎng)中的位置、定向和縮放;在視場(chǎng)中的位置處虛擬放置對(duì)應(yīng)的CG,以便具有AR標(biāo)記圖像的位置、定向和縮放;第二AR分析器(3B)計(jì)算CG對(duì)象相對(duì)于在由相機(jī)隨后捕獲的第二捕獲圖像在視場(chǎng)中的位置處虛擬放置的立體圖;CG呈現(xiàn)單元(5)在第二捕獲圖像中相應(yīng)位置處合成具有所述位置、定向和縮放的CG對(duì)象的圖像;并且在顯示器(7)上顯示所合成的圖像。
【專(zhuān)利說(shuō)明】圖像處理裝置和圖像處理方法
【技術(shù)領(lǐng)域】
[0001] 本發(fā)明涉及采用了 AR標(biāo)記和自然特征追蹤方法的組合的AR圖像處理裝置和方 法。
【背景技術(shù)】
[0002] 在許多領(lǐng)域中,已經(jīng)采用了這樣的AR圖像處理裝置,所述AR圖像處理裝置被配置 為通過(guò)使用增強(qiáng)現(xiàn)實(shí)(AR)技術(shù)來(lái)在諸如AR標(biāo)記圖像之類(lèi)的目標(biāo)對(duì)象圖像上實(shí)時(shí)地合成CG 對(duì)象,所述目標(biāo)對(duì)象圖像是由作為諸如網(wǎng)絡(luò)相機(jī)或數(shù)字視頻相機(jī)之類(lèi)的圖像捕獲設(shè)備的相 機(jī)所捕獲的。
[0003] 基于標(biāo)記的AR技術(shù)涉及:在形成具有數(shù)字圖像中的特定形狀的組的高級(jí)特征點(diǎn) 中進(jìn)行登記;通過(guò)使用單應(yīng)矩陣等來(lái)從由圖像捕獲設(shè)備捕獲的數(shù)字圖像中檢測(cè)所登記的特 征點(diǎn);估計(jì)組的位置和姿態(tài)等;并且在與組的位置和姿態(tài)等對(duì)應(yīng)的AR標(biāo)記圖像的位置處合 成并顯示CG對(duì)象。
[0004] 在該AR技術(shù)中,事先登記并且具有特定形狀的特征點(diǎn)被稱(chēng)為AR標(biāo)記(或簡(jiǎn)稱(chēng)為 "標(biāo)記")。通過(guò)在標(biāo)記的登記中增加用于指示現(xiàn)實(shí)世界中的標(biāo)記的尺寸和姿態(tài)的額外信息, 可以在一定程度上準(zhǔn)確地估計(jì)到從圖像捕獲設(shè)備獲取的數(shù)字圖像中的AR標(biāo)記的距離和所 述AR標(biāo)記的尺寸。而且,當(dāng)在數(shù)字圖像中不存在可識(shí)別的特征點(diǎn)時(shí),顯然無(wú)法估計(jì)標(biāo)記的 位置和姿態(tài)。
[0005] 基于自然特征追蹤的AR技術(shù)(其典型代表為PTAM( "Parallel Tracking and Mapping for Small AR Workspaces (小型AR工作空間的并行追蹤和映射)〃,牛津大學(xué))) 是優(yōu)秀的方法,其不需要在數(shù)字圖像中事先登記特征點(diǎn),并且其允許以任意方向和向任何 位置移動(dòng)圖像捕獲設(shè)備,只要能夠追蹤特征點(diǎn)即可,即便當(dāng)連續(xù)移動(dòng)圖像捕獲設(shè)備的位置 時(shí)也是如此。
[0006] 然而,由于需要首先指定基礎(chǔ)位置,因此需要以特定方式來(lái)移動(dòng)圖像捕獲設(shè)備,以 根據(jù)隨著相機(jī)的移動(dòng)而捕獲的多個(gè)圖像中的特征點(diǎn)的移動(dòng)量來(lái)確定基礎(chǔ)位置,并且需要額 外地提供位置和姿態(tài)信息。在這個(gè)過(guò)程中,除非正確地移動(dòng)圖像捕獲設(shè)備,否則無(wú)法準(zhǔn)確地 確定基礎(chǔ)平面。此外,在基于自然特征追蹤的AR技術(shù)中,由于因?yàn)榧夹g(shù)的特性而通常沒(méi)有 執(zhí)行特征點(diǎn)的事先登記,因此無(wú)法準(zhǔn)確地知曉與所捕獲的數(shù)字圖像中的特征點(diǎn)的尺寸和所 述特征點(diǎn)之間的距離相關(guān)的信息。因此,存在通常使用的這樣的方法,即相對(duì)于基礎(chǔ)平面來(lái) 手動(dòng)設(shè)置CG對(duì)象的尺寸、方向和位置。
[0007] 現(xiàn)有技術(shù)文獻(xiàn)
[0008] 專(zhuān)利文獻(xiàn)
[0009] 專(zhuān)利文獻(xiàn)1 :日本專(zhuān)利申請(qǐng)公開(kāi)No. 2011-141828
[0010] 專(zhuān)利文獻(xiàn)2 :日本專(zhuān)利申請(qǐng)公開(kāi)No. 2012-003598
【發(fā)明內(nèi)容】
toon] 本發(fā)明要解決的問(wèn)題
[0012] 本發(fā)明的目的在于提供一種AR圖像處理方法和裝置,其集成了常規(guī)的基于標(biāo)記 的AR技術(shù)和常規(guī)的基于自然特征追蹤的AR技術(shù)這兩者的優(yōu)勢(shì),并且在由相機(jī)捕獲的自然 景致等的數(shù)字圖像上適當(dāng)?shù)睾铣刹@示CG對(duì)象。
[0013] 更具體而言,本發(fā)明的目的在于提供一種AR圖像處理方法和裝置,其能夠以準(zhǔn)確 的位置、尺寸和姿態(tài)而不需要手動(dòng)定位操作,在由相機(jī)捕獲的自然景致等的數(shù)字圖像上實(shí) 時(shí)地合成并顯示CG對(duì)象,并且即使在向各個(gè)位置并且在各個(gè)方向上移動(dòng)所述相機(jī)時(shí),其也 能夠?qū)崿F(xiàn)實(shí)際再現(xiàn)。
[0014] 解決問(wèn)題的方案
[0015] 本發(fā)明提供的AR圖像處理方法包括如下步驟:包括如下步驟:獲取由相機(jī)捕獲并 且包括AR標(biāo)記及其周邊環(huán)境的固定視場(chǎng)中的場(chǎng)景;使得第一 AR分析器分析由所述相機(jī)捕 獲并且包括AR標(biāo)記圖像及其周邊環(huán)境的所述場(chǎng)景的第一捕獲圖像,確定所述AR標(biāo)記圖像 在所述視場(chǎng)中的位置、姿態(tài)和縮放,并且在與所述AR標(biāo)記圖像的位置、姿態(tài)和縮放相對(duì)應(yīng) 的所述視場(chǎng)中在適當(dāng)?shù)奈恢锰幪摂M放置對(duì)應(yīng)的CG對(duì)象;使得第二AR分析器針對(duì)在第一視 場(chǎng)中在適當(dāng)?shù)奈恢锰幪摂M放置的CG對(duì)象來(lái)計(jì)算所述CG對(duì)象在由所述相機(jī)在第二視場(chǎng)中隨 后捕獲的第二捕獲圖像中的所述相機(jī)的所述第二視場(chǎng)中的外觀;使得CG呈現(xiàn)單元在所述 相機(jī)的第二捕獲圖像中的適當(dāng)?shù)奈恢锰幒铣稍谒?jì)算出的外觀中的所述CG對(duì)象的圖像; 以及使得顯示單元顯示所合成的圖像。
[0016] 此外,本發(fā)明提供的AR圖像處理裝置包括:相機(jī);第一 AR分析器,被配置為分析 由所述相機(jī)捕獲并且包括AR標(biāo)記及其周邊環(huán)境的視場(chǎng)中的場(chǎng)景的第一捕獲圖像,確定AR 標(biāo)記圖像在所述視場(chǎng)中的位置、姿態(tài)和縮放,并且在與所述AR標(biāo)記圖像的位置、姿態(tài)和縮 放相對(duì)應(yīng)的所述視場(chǎng)中在適當(dāng)?shù)奈恢锰幪摂M放置對(duì)應(yīng)的CG對(duì)象;第二AR分析器,被配置為 針對(duì)在所述第一視場(chǎng)中在適當(dāng)?shù)奈恢锰幪摂M放置的所述CG對(duì)象來(lái)計(jì)算所述CG對(duì)象在由所 述相機(jī)在第二視場(chǎng)中隨后捕獲的第二捕獲圖像中的所述相機(jī)的所述第二視場(chǎng)中的外觀;CG 呈現(xiàn)單元,被配置為在由所述第二AR分析器獲取的所述相機(jī)的第二捕獲圖像中的適當(dāng)?shù)?位置處合成所述CG對(duì)象在計(jì)算出的外觀中的圖像;以及顯示單元,被配置為顯示由所述CG 呈現(xiàn)單元所合成的圖像。
[0017] 本發(fā)明的效果
[0018] 本發(fā)明的AR圖像處理技術(shù)能夠以準(zhǔn)確的位置、準(zhǔn)確的尺寸和姿態(tài)而不需要手動(dòng) 定位操作,在由相機(jī)捕獲的自然景致等的數(shù)字圖像上實(shí)時(shí)地合成并顯示CG對(duì)象,并且即使 在向各個(gè)位置并且在各個(gè)方向上移動(dòng)所述相機(jī)時(shí),其也能夠?qū)崿F(xiàn)實(shí)際再現(xiàn)。
【專(zhuān)利附圖】
【附圖說(shuō)明】
[0019] 圖1是示出了本發(fā)明中的第一 AR分析器的視景體空間和第二AR分析器的視景體 空間的示意圖。
[0020] 圖2是示出了本發(fā)明中的第一 AR分析器的視景體空間和以在視景體空間中檢測(cè) 到的標(biāo)記圖像的位置為原點(diǎn)的坐標(biāo)之間的關(guān)系的示意圖。
[0021] 圖3是在本發(fā)明中使用的AR標(biāo)記和與所述AR標(biāo)記對(duì)應(yīng)的CG對(duì)象圖像的示意圖。
[0022] 圖4是示出了本發(fā)明中的第一 AR分析器的視景體空間中檢測(cè)到的標(biāo)記圖像和與 所述標(biāo)記圖像相對(duì)應(yīng)的CG對(duì)象的示意圖。
[0023] 圖5是通常的針孔相機(jī)模型中的視景體的定義的示意圖。
[0024] 圖6是本發(fā)明一個(gè)實(shí)施例中的AR圖像處理裝置的框圖。
[0025] 圖7是本發(fā)明一個(gè)實(shí)施例中的AR圖像處理方法的流程圖。
[0026] 圖8A是實(shí)施例中的AR合成圖像,并且是以相機(jī)能夠捕獲整個(gè)AR標(biāo)記的角度捕獲 的圖像的AR合成圖像。
[0027] 圖8B是實(shí)施例中的AR合成圖像,并且是以相機(jī)無(wú)法捕獲AR標(biāo)記的向上角度捕獲 的圖像的AR合成圖像。
【具體實(shí)施方式】
[0028] 在下文中基于附圖詳細(xì)地描述本發(fā)明的實(shí)施例。
[0029] 首先,描述本發(fā)明的主旨??傮w而言,為了分析由諸如網(wǎng)絡(luò)相機(jī)或數(shù)字視頻相機(jī)之 類(lèi)的具有AR分析器的相機(jī)捕獲的數(shù)字圖像,并且隨后基于數(shù)字圖像中的特定目標(biāo)對(duì)象的 圖像上的位置信息在數(shù)字圖像上合成并顯示CG對(duì)象,需要將空間中的CG對(duì)象投影變換為 數(shù)字圖像。在執(zhí)行這樣的投影變換的AR分析器中,需要?jiǎng)?chuàng)建4X4的投影矩陣P和4X4的 模型視圖矩陣M。被配置為檢測(cè)由相機(jī)捕獲的數(shù)字圖像中的目標(biāo)對(duì)象圖像的位置的第一 AR 分析器A的投影變換被表達(dá)為:
[0030] [數(shù)學(xué)公式1]
[0031]
【權(quán)利要求】
1. 一種AR圖像處理方法,包括如下步驟: 獲取由相機(jī)捕獲并且包括AR標(biāo)記及其周邊環(huán)境的第一視場(chǎng)中的場(chǎng)景的第一捕獲圖 像; 使得第一 AR分析器分析由所述相機(jī)捕獲并且包括AR標(biāo)記圖像及其周邊環(huán)境的所述場(chǎng) 景的第一捕獲圖像,確定所述AR標(biāo)記圖像在所述第一視場(chǎng)中的位置、姿態(tài)和縮放,并且在 與所述AR標(biāo)記圖像的位置、姿態(tài)和縮放相對(duì)應(yīng)的所述第一視場(chǎng)中在適當(dāng)?shù)奈恢锰幪摂M放 置對(duì)應(yīng)的CG對(duì)象; 使得第二AR分析器針對(duì)在所述第一視場(chǎng)中在適當(dāng)?shù)奈恢锰幪摂M放置的CG對(duì)象來(lái)計(jì)算 所述CG對(duì)象在由所述相機(jī)在第二視場(chǎng)中隨后捕獲的第二捕獲圖像中的所述相機(jī)的所述第 二視場(chǎng)中的外觀; 使得CG呈現(xiàn)單元在所述相機(jī)的第二捕獲圖像中的適當(dāng)?shù)奈恢锰幒铣稍谒龅诙晥?chǎng) 中的外觀中的所述CG對(duì)象的圖像;以及 使得顯示單元顯示所合成的圖像。
2. -種AR圖像處理裝置,包括: 相機(jī); 第一 AR分析器,被配置為分析由所述相機(jī)捕獲并且包括AR標(biāo)記及其周邊環(huán)境的第一 視場(chǎng)中的場(chǎng)景的第一捕獲圖像,確定AR標(biāo)記圖像在所述第一視場(chǎng)中的位置、姿態(tài)和縮放, 并且在與所述AR標(biāo)記圖像的位置、姿態(tài)和縮放相對(duì)應(yīng)的所述第一視場(chǎng)中在適當(dāng)?shù)奈恢锰?虛擬放置對(duì)應(yīng)的CG對(duì)象; 第二AR分析器,被配置為針對(duì)在所述第一視場(chǎng)中在適當(dāng)?shù)奈恢锰幪摂M放置的所述CG 對(duì)象來(lái)計(jì)算所述CG對(duì)象在由所述相機(jī)在第二視場(chǎng)中隨后捕獲的第二捕獲圖像中的所述相 機(jī)的所述第二視場(chǎng)中的外觀; CG呈現(xiàn)單元,被配置為在由所述第二AR分析器獲取的所述相機(jī)的第二捕獲圖像中的 適當(dāng)?shù)奈恢锰幒铣稍谒龅诙晥?chǎng)中的外觀中所述CG對(duì)象的圖像;以及 顯示單元,被配置為顯示由所述CG呈現(xiàn)單元所合成的圖像。
【文檔編號(hào)】G06T19/00GK104160426SQ201280069773
【公開(kāi)日】2014年11月19日 申請(qǐng)日期:2012年10月31日 優(yōu)先權(quán)日:2012年2月22日
【發(fā)明者】伊藤和彥 申請(qǐng)人:株式會(huì)社微網(wǎng)